以下是一个简单的PHP直播交互实例,我们将创建一个基本的直播平台,用户可以实时发送消息,其他用户可以实时接收这些消息。
1. 环境准备
- PHP环境
- MySQL数据库
- Web服务器(如Apache或Nginx)
2. 数据库设计
我们首先需要创建一个数据库表来存储用户消息。

```sql
CREATE TABLE messages (
id INT AUTO_INCREMENT PRIMARY KEY,
username VARCHAR(50),
message TEXT,
timestamp DATETIME DEFAULT CURRENT_TIMESTAMP
);
```
3. PHP代码实现
3.1 用户发送消息
```php
// 检查用户是否已登录
session_start();
if (!isset($_SESSION['username'])) {
header('Location: login.php');
exit();
}
// 连接数据库
$mysqli = new mysqli("









